Ques: What is the salary after BSc Physics?

There are multiple variables that affect the starting salary such as the applicant's expertise and the industry they are based out of. Additionally, someone's location also plays a role in this element. For example, having a BSc in Physics can land you a job that pays roughly around ₹3-6 lakhs on average annually. Entry Level Positions in data analysis, research, and teaching are typically at modest starting salaries. However, for some roles in engineering firms and tech companies, it can be higher with some jobs paying more than ₹6 lakhs a year.

While doing an MSc or PhD in Physics highly improves the salary aspects, there is a significant emphasis on research and teaching jobs. Having additional qualifications in data science, engineering or finance makes you a highly desirable candidate which directly speaks to the increase in salary a typical graduate makes. In essence, having advanced education in combination with experience, enables you to take advantage great earning potential in fields such as IT, finance, or R&D.
